You gotta love them, the Vogue Paris editors (obviously I do!). Not only how they dress alike--despite all the fashion peacocking around the international runway shows-- but also how they stay true to their understated yet polished uniforms, anchored in jeans (which I've highlighted here before) and pointy-toe pumps. Photographed in Milan last week, they demonstrate that the black pump looks equally sexy with a high and low heel. I also have an affinity for these shoes, but they have to be the right kind, with a leg-enhancing heel height and foot-flattering cutaway. I swear by Christian Louboutin's Pigalle 100mm black pumps. In fact, I have them in the beige as well. They are forever shoes--i.e. the kind worth investing in. Other styles that hit the Gallic-chic spot: Gianvito Rossi's suede mid-heels (90mm), Jimmy Choo's patent leather kitten heels, Manolo Blahnik's classic BB pumps, Sole Society's black suede shoes, Topshop's straight-up version, and Alexander Wang's ankle strap kitten heels.

It actually cooled down in LA the other night just enough for me to bust out my new faux fur citron-hued Topshop vest. Yes, I already own more fur vests than is practical or even sane, especially in LA, but this layering staple is so easy to justify, with its ability to be worn under my army and moto jackets and over filmy dresses and, well, really just about anything, as demonstrated in the pics above and below (note how they're worn in both warm and cold climates). Plus, the citron color is so different, so unexpected, so not like seasons past. Just so good! Spurred by my pat-myself-on-the-back-enthusiam (and in the wake of compliments I received the other night!), I sought out a few more furry, fresh-looking vests, like this one and this one from Dorothy Perkins, both so tempting (and inexpensive!), along with these plush guys from Twelfth Street by Cynthia Vincent, Steve Madden, and Scotch & Soda.
